网站大量收购闲置独家精品文档,联系QQ:2885784924

SVN本地学习环境快速搭建.pdf

  1. 1、本文档共8页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
SVN本地学习环境快速搭建.pdf

SVN 本地学习环境快速搭建 SVN 是程序员必须熟悉的一个工具 ,真正理解这个工具的工作原理还是需要些时间的 , 但是我们不妨先去多实践,多实验 ,多去看文档,可以自己在 windows 中配置一个 SVN 的 server,然后将自己学习中各种项目都放入自己的 SVN server 中,然后不断练习,慢慢的就会 有很大提高。 SVN 是个标准的 c/s 结构软件系统,我们必须同时具备 SVN server 以及 SVN client 然后 整个系统才能正常的工作。我们至少在这样的一个系统上才能真正学习、工作等。 SVN 客户端程序一般比较流行的是 TortoiseSVN,这个是图形化的 SVN 客户端软件, 操作简单,易用,同资源管理器集成等。他的安装比较简单,默认 next 方式安装就可以。 目前有了 client 还欠缺一个 server 端程序,若是两个都具备了我们就可以进行研究了 。 一般 SVN server 安装还是略微麻烦些的。其实出于学习目的我们完全没有必要专门安 装一套 SVN server 系统。在正常开发环境中,一定会有专人负责 SVN 的维护等,主要维护 的 server 系统。因此我们仅仅需要一个最简单的、仅供自己学习的 SVN 系统,不需要太多 功能。 这个系统 TortoiseSVN 已经为我们提供了,我们仅仅需要简单设置一下就可以工作了 。 本文将较为详细的介绍一下这个操作过程,供大家参考。 一. 创建 SVN 仓库 如上图 1. 在硬盘中,创建一个空的目录,本例中创建 z:\repos 目录作为仓库目录 2. 在目录中 任意空白处点击 鼠标右键,选取图中菜单项 3. 最后选择“Create repository here”项目 这样客户端就会在这里创建一个 file:///类型的服务器仓库。 二.仓库地址获取与维护 如上图,还是在刚才创的目录中,已经包含了仓库必备文件。千万不要手工修改这些文件 , 这些文件必须由 TortoiseSVN 软件进行维护,否则可能破坏仓库造成损失。 如何获取仓库地址,这样才能进行后续 SVN 操作 1. 在仓库中任意空白处(位置 2 的地方),选择鼠标右键 2. 依次点选图中菜单,最后选择 repo-browser 最后将获得下图界面 如上图,其中 1. 图中 位置 1 处是 当前仓库的 SVN 操作地址 2. 图中 位置 2 处是 当前仓库的内容,目前刚刚创建里面内容是空的。 下面进行如下仓库操作来维护仓库,记住操作仓库相当于操作 SVN server 如上图,在仓库空白处,任意位置 单击鼠标右键,出现弹出菜单,用户可以选择 create folder 菜单,可以创建仓库中各项内容。如图中我创建一个目录 “myserver” 下图是创建完目录“myserver”后的结果 如上图, 图中位置 1 处就是 目前 SVN 仓库中相关地址 三.创建本地的 eclipse 项目作为导入 SVN 的工作内容 下 图 是 创 建 本 地 eclipse java 项 目 后 的 结 果 , 从 图 中 我 们 可 以 看 到 我 们 在 z:\local_work\MySVNTest 目录下创建 java 项目,详情请查阅 eclipse 的操作等 下面我们将导入 eclipse 项目到 SVN 仓库中 如上图,我们将进行如下步骤 1. 调整显示 eclipse 项目的资源管理器位置及大小到图中相对位置及大小 2. 调整 SVN 仓库浏览窗口到图中位置及大小 3. 移动鼠标到图中位置 2 处 4. 按下鼠标左键不放手,拖动文件向位置 4 移动 5. 在鼠标移动到位置 4 处后,释放鼠标左键 这时候会显示如下相关菜单 如上图,在位置 3 处显示两个弹出菜单,用户在这里选择任何一个菜单都可以。 这

文档评论(0)

tangtianxu1 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档